As a BCaBA, you will work under the supervision of a BCBA to implement behavior intervention plans, conduct assessments, and provide support to clients and their families. This role is ideal for individuals who are looking to gain experience in the field while making a meaningful difference.

Job Responsibilities

  • Implement and monitor behavior intervention plans
  • Provide behavior treatment by protocol to clients, as-needed
  • Conduct functional assessments and gather data
  • Collaborate with BCBA to develop and modify treatment plans
  • Provide training and support to parents and caregivers
  • Ensure data is collected and recorded with fidelity and reliability
  • Assist behavior analysts in protocol modification, assessments, family treatment guidance, treatment planning and clinical programming
  • Provide clinical direction to technicians, as-needed
  • Document services delivered accurately and timely according to company policies
  • Report clinical and scheduling concerns promptly
  • Adhere to all company compliance policies, written or unwritten
  • Complete other tasks as assigned by BCBA supervisor

Required Skills and Qualifications

  • Bachelor’s degree in Psychology, Education, ABA, Special Education or related field
  • Current BCaBA certification or scheduled to sit for the BCaBA exam in the next two months
  • Certification, registration, and/or license as required by local statutes to deliver behavior treatment
  • Experience in ABA therapy or working with clients with Autism Spectrum Disorders (ASD) preferred
  • Reliable transportation
  • Strong communication and interpersonal skills
  • Ability to work independently and as part of a team
  • Passion for working with children and families
